What is Losartan?

Losartan has active ingredients of losartan potassium. It is often used in high blood pressure. eHealthMe is studying from 177,692 Losartan users. Check the latest studies of Losartan.

What is Videx?

Videx has active ingredients of didanosine. eHealthMe is studying from 7,927 Videx users. Check the latest studies of Videx.

How the study uses the data?

The study uses data from the FDA. It is based on losartan potassium and didanosine (the active ingredients of Losartan and Videx, respectively), and Losartan and Videx (the brand names). Other drugs that have the same active ingredients (e.g. generic drugs) are not considered. Dosage of drugs is not considered in the study.
